Problem

The HogQL-powered event explorer lost the ability to save columns as project defaults.

Changes

Brings it back, and provides a one-way migration path: enabling the flag migrates your columns (and only on override), removing the flag after an override resets back to the default columns.

It also looks and works exactly the same as before.
